Robin Valeri

Robin Maria Valeri, Ph.D., Professor of Psychology, St. Bonaventure University, earned a BA from Cornell University and an MA and PhD from Syracuse University. Her research interests include hate, hate groups, terrorism, internet/social media, and social influence. Valeri is co-editor of Terrorism in America and Hate Crimes: Victims, Motivations and Typologies and co-author of Skinhead History, Identity and Culture as well as co-author of several chapters including Sticks and Stones: When the words of hatred become weapons in Global Perspectives on Youth Gang Behavior, Violence, and Weapons and Masculine Identities within the Skinhead Movement in Advances in Sociology Research (2016).
